I must have a wicked mind because i never considered Fllay a *insert swearword*, instead of that i was very touch by her character. She was the most human and the most realistic character in term of reaction. There is no way a 16 old teenager would enlist in the army and be strong enought to keep up with the stress of war, she is a meer civilian who get caught in the fury of war and breaksdown due to stress, death of her father and fear. It s also natural for anyone to have some racist reaction especially when you are in war with the same, and i dont think she was the same kind as the blue cosmos guys, when she is ask if she is a blue cosmos she is shocked about this question.
